In fcc unit cell , what is the volume occupied ?

A

`4/3 pir^3`

B

`8/3 pi r^3`

C

`16/3 pi r^3`

D

`(64r^3)/(3sqrt3)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

The volume occupied by the fcc unit cell is `16/3 pi r^3`
Packing fraction or volume occupied `=(Z_(eff)xx4/3pir^3)/(a^3)`
For fcc, `Z_(eff) = 4`
`=(4xx4/3pir^3)/(a^3)` (where , a=1)

`=16/3 pir^3`
